Spot Devices Reno, Nevada

Description

The Internet-enabled SC320 Network Controller powers and controls Rectangular Rapid Flashing Beacons (RRFBs), round beacons, LED warning signs, and In-Road Warning Lights (IRWLs) from a pole-mounted enclosure. The SC320 can provide for wireless activation of devices attached to other Spot Devices network controllers. In addition, the SC320 can provide audible warnings upon activation. Internet connectivity permits "from anywhere" activation, monitoring and configuration. SC320 systems are available in both AC and solar power configurations.

Specifications

POWER  
AC 120 VAC, 600W AC-to-DC converter
Solar 12 VDC, 20W or 90W solar panel with 105 AHr battery
   
OPERATING CHARACTERISTICS  
Other peripheral device connection capacity IRWLs, RRFBs, beacons, LED signs
Configuration Internet-enabled user interface
Wireless frequencies GPRS/EDGE, GPS and 2.4GHz spread-spectrum local wireless
   
PHYSICAL CHARACTERISTICS  
Enclosure NEMA3R compliant aluminum (NEMA4X available upon request)
Weight AC systems: 55 pounds
  Solar systems: 45 pounds plus 100 pounds for 105 AHr battery
Dimensions 24"H x 14"W x 8"D
